Project Controls Engineer 3 (JP2987)
Compa Industries is searching for qualified candidates for a Project Controls Engineer position at the Los Alamos National Laboratory in Los Alamos, NM .
Salary: $60/hr - $65/hr
Location: Los Alamos, NM (Onsite)
Citizenship: US citizenship Required
Work Schedule: 9/80A schedule
Clearance: Ability to acquire a Q-clearance needed
Per Diem: Approved
The Project Controls Engineer plays an integral role in supporting Los Alamos National Laboratory’s Earned Value Management System (EVMS) and Project Controls System. This position is pivotal to the Laboratory’s ability to track progress, manage costs, and meet project milestones. With a broad range of experience, the engineer will resolve complex challenges creatively and effectively, contribute to the development of new methods, and provide expert guidance that influences the Laboratory's success.
